## Changelog — Fontrel 3.2 (for weekly eng sync)

Defaults changed: Fontrel now vendors all third-party fonts at build time instead of fetching them from the Glyphden CDN at runtime. This removes the runtime network dependency that caused the flash-of-unstyled-text reports from the Varnholm pilot. The vendoring step runs in CI, hashes each font file, and fails the build on checksum drift. Teams that previously pinned CDN versions should delete those pins; the build now owns them. The new pipeline ships with the following defaults baked in.

config for tawif-bagef:
[sorwyn]
team = sorys
access_code = ac_9ba40c
host = sorwyn.ordingrid.local
port = 5000
owner = aldok.quenion
peer = belath.paliqcloud.local

Hi,

As discussed in last week's planning sync, ownership of the ScaleKitchen recipe-scaling calculator is moving out of the Pantry Tools group effective next sprint. This covers release coordination, hotfix approvals, and the fraction-rounding module that caused the 2.3.1 patch. Please update the release checklist and route all pending change requests accordingly, including the two open items on unit conversion. Documentation stays with the current wiki owners for now. The new responsible party for all releases is named below.

account owner for bawip-tahag: Raleth Quenok

Hey — welcome aboard. The Lattermark timetable solver on staging has drifted from what's in the repo; someone hand-edited constraint weights last term and never committed. Don't trust the manifest until we reconcile. For reference while you audit, here's what the service is actually running with right now.

config for kafof-bawef:
holath:
  log_level: debug
  metrics_host: metrics.holath.qorvelsys.internal
  pin: 2191
  pool_size: 32